Abstract
Jacketed rotary converter. The converter includes an inclined pot mounted for rotation about a longitudinal axis, a refractory lining for holding a molten alloy pool, an opening in a top of the pot for introducing feed, a lance for injecting oxygen-containing gas, a heat transfer jacket for the pot adjacent the refractory lining, and a coolant system to circulate a heat transfer medium through the jacket to remove heat from the alloy pool in thermal communication with the refractory lining. Also disclosed is a PGM converting process using the jacketed rotary converter. The process can also include low-or no-flux converting; refractory protectant addition; slag separation; partial feed pre-oxidation; staged slagging; and/or smelting the slag in a secondary furnace with primary furnace slag.
